cout<<"GLFW create window failed. Invoke glfwCreateWindow()."<<std::endl; glfwTerminate(); exit(EXIT_FAILURE); } //“上下文”是指OpenGL 实例及其状态信息,其中包括诸如颜色缓冲区之类的项 //创建GLFW 窗口并不会自动将它与当前OpenGL 上下文关联起来——因此我们需要调用glfwMakeContextCurrent()。 glfwMa...
if (!glfwInit()) { fprintf(stderr, "Failed to initialize GLFW "); return -1; } 如果GLFW 初始化失败,它将返回 GL_FALSE,并且你可以通过 glfwGetError 函数获取错误信息。 检查图形驱动程序是否支持并正确安装: 确保你的系统安装了正确的图形驱动程序,并且这些驱动程序支持你尝试使用的 OpenGL 版本。你...
void Window::Create(std::string title) { glfwSetErrorCallback(error_callback); if (GL_TRUE != glfwInit()) { AC_CORE_ASSERT("Failed to initialize GLFW. This could be a problem with your hardware or software."); } else { window = glfwCreateWindow(500, 600, "Acorn Engine", nullptr,...
包括 DX 和 OpenGL 等等的封装,利用此封装可以用来代替原有的 SharpDx 等库。
在Express的作者的TJ Holowaychuk的 告别Node.js一文中列举了以下罪状: Farewell NodeJS (TJ Holoway...
{std::cout<<"Failed to create GLFW window!"<<std::endl;charmyvar1;std::cin>> myvar1; glfwTerminate();return-1; } glfwMakeContextCurrent(window); glewExperimental = GL_TRUE;if(glewInit() != GL_TRUE) {std::cout<<"Failed to initialize GLEW"<<std::endl;charmyvar2;std::cin>> my...
window, err := glfw.CreateWindow(int(g.Width),int(g.Height), g.Title,nil,nil)iferr !=nil{returnfmt.Errorf("glfw.CreateWindowfailed: %s", err) } window.MakeContextCurrent()// Initialize Glowiferr := gl.Init(); err !=nil{returnfmt.Errorf("gl.Init failed:", err) ...
importorg.lwjgl.glfw.GLFW;//导入方法依赖的package包/类publicstaticWindowgenerate(WindowHandle handle){longwindowID = GLFW.glfwCreateWindow(handle.width, handle.height, handle.title, NULL, NULL);if(windowID == NULL)thrownewGLFWException("Failed to create GLFW Window '"+ handle.title +"'"); ...
throw new RuntimeException("Failed to create the GLFW window"); 代码示例来源:origin: playn/playn window = glfwCreateWindow(width, height, config.appName, monitor, 0); if (window == 0) throw new RuntimeException("Failed to create window; see error log."); 代码示例来源:origin: lwjglgame...
武某向一审法院起诉请求: 新东方迅程公司支付武某: 1、违法解除劳动合同赔偿金486400元; 2、2020年...